Manchester United will play Liverpool in their third game of the new Premier League season. Liverpool beat United 5-0 at Old Trafford and 4-0 at Anfield last season, and Erik ten Hag will be looking to prevent another embarrassing scoreline in his third game in charge.

United's game against Liverpool is pencilled in for 3pm on Saturday 20 August, but the kick-off time and potentially the date of the game will be amended in the coming weeks for TV broadcasting purposes.

United are due to visit Anfield on Saturday 4 March. ALSO READ: Marcus Rashford is already proving his United critics wrong United also won't have to wait much longer for the Manchester derby, with Ten Hag's side set to visit City at the Etihad on Saturday 1 October.

United lost 4-1 against City when making the trip to the Etihad under Ralf Rangnick last term. The Reds are down to play City at Old Trafford on Saturday 14 January, which will be their second game of the New Year. United's key fixtures (dates subject to change and kick-off times to be confirmed) United have a reasonable run of fixtures to end the season, with their final five games scheduled against Aston Villa, West Ham, Wolverhampton, Bournemouth and Fulham.
